chub



Pronunciation: (chub), [key]
n.,
pl. (esp. collectively) chub, (esp. referring to two or more kinds or species) chubs.

1. a common freshwater fish, Leuciscus cephalus, of European waters, having a thick, fusiform body.
2. any of various related fishes.
3. any of several unrelated American fishes, esp. the tautog and whitefishes of the genus Coregonus, of the Great Lakes.
